What is internet disintermediation? Between manufacturers and consumers, distributors are intermediaries. The internet threatens to eliminate intermediary roles that provide low-value-added services, with distributors being the first to go. Layer upon layer of middlemen, each adding their markup, mean that the price we pay in physical stores includes not just the cost of goods but also the cumulative margins of many intermediate steps. Disintermediation could greatly reduce channel costs and thus lower retail prices. It sounds perfectly reasonable, but goods have not only production costs but also distribution costs, service costs, brand costs, information costs, and emotional costs. Intermediaries provide capital, bear risks, find buyers, facilitate transactions, and offer services. Merchants are the air, the water, the blood that nourish factories, consumers, and themselves. Intermediaries act as lubricants and reservoirs between manufacturers and end-users, reducing friction and improving transaction efficiency. Among the "scalpers," a natural distribution system has evolved. What do intermediaries actually earn?

First, they earn interest on the capital they advance.

Second, they bear storage, transportation, and price depreciation risks, earning risk compensation.

Third, they provide a bundle of services—display, consultation, sales, warehousing, and delivery—earning service fees. E-commerce brings us abundance and convenience, not necessarily low prices. Just as Didi may solve the problem of getting a ride, not necessarily cheaper rides. While the internet addresses connectivity needs, e-commerce itself is a new form of intermediary. True direct sales incur communication, interaction, logistics, and information costs far higher than a normal distribution model that follows market logic. For instance, Amway's direct sales products are not cheap. Goods bought through B2B matchmaking platforms are not necessarily cheaper than those from an offline matchmaking company. The value of channels and social division of labor Disintermediation means de-specialization, which goes against economic laws. Intermediary channels are a natural result of social division of labor, and their value is severely underestimated. In a complex upstream-downstream environment, the existence of intermediary distribution channels reduces the workload between upstream and downstream to a manageable level. Otherwise, information flow, capital flow, and logistics would face various problems, not to mention the "strong personal relationships" common in B2B. Of course, in a concentrated ecosystem, direct upstream-downstream connections are entirely reasonable, but in such ecosystems, transactional B2B is almost useless. SaaS-based direct enterprise connections and collaboration might play a larger role. Conversely, trying to enter complex transaction channel ecosystems through enterprise collaboration software is extremely difficult. The value of intermediaries has shifted from exploiting information asymmetry to providing logistics, trust, and interactive services. We must truly recognize the value of B2B e-commerce: we are not here to eliminate intermediaries but to improve the efficiency of connections between enterprises and their people. The internet itself does not represent efficiency gains; rather, efficiency gains often leverage internet tools and models. Internet ≠ Efficiency Most people think that with the internet, efficiency improves—look at Taobao, WeChat, JD. Indeed, many B2C internet projects have created immense value by improving the efficiency of connecting people. But B2B is ultimately about business-to-business. From an economic perspective, any large-scale organizational form will experience diminishing marginal returns beyond a certain point. Internet ≠ Efficiency; simply scaling up B2B does not necessarily lead to efficiency gains. Internet efficiency gains have a concept of minimum synergy effect. For example, a city can generate same-city synergy like ride-hailing. The higher the coverage and penetration in a city, the greater the efficiency gains. But the minimum synergy effect for many B2B projects may vary greatly depending on the ecosystem; it might require national coverage to achieve synergy, or a very small organization might already be a natural synergy unit. Many unvalidated models, driven by rapid data growth, assume that scaling up will inevitably lead to increasing marginal returns, reducing costs and achieving profitability. However, scaling does not necessarily bring increasing marginal returns. If the best you get is linear growth, then from the internet's perspective, you haven't gained efficiency-driven value. The direct manifestation is that projects cannot rely on the business model itself to become profitable in the mid-to-late stages—this is the current situation and dilemma for many B2B projects. So we need to find the minimum synergy scale for connecting enterprises and their people, and link these minimum-scale organizations in appropriate ways. There are many tactical approaches. In summary, B2B needs to: Play the role of a bridge B2B relies on strong relationships. How to leverage these relationships, activate existing stock, and not just improve management efficiency to find incremental growth? Under overcapacity, B2B has little incremental growth; only by reconstructing the original ecosystem's connection methods can we develop efficient models to serve the ecosystem. In different ecosystems, the core connecting 'b' can take various forms. The more information asymmetry and the heavier the reliance on personal relationships, the harder it is to transform or improve the original ecosystem. In such ecosystems, the connecting 'b' is best served by people. Using people faces the challenge of scaling. In such models, semi-automated, efficiently organized human-plus-internet-product combinations are suitable. Since early-stage models are often unclear, demanding high usage of internet products from the start is unrealistic. Efficiency is the best criterion for viability. Cleverly integrating existing industry people or organizations to improve efficiency is key. The role of labor costs in operations must be optimized, gradually finding more reasonable and efficient models that let internet products realize their value. If you merely follow traditional industry practices, efficiency gains will be insufficient. For example, a listed B2B company in Zhejiang, let's call it "XXBao," promoted supply chain finance based on transaction credit limits for core enterprises across Jiangsu and Zhejiang. The interest seemed low, using bank funds. The credit was only extended to core enterprises, without verifying whether they actually passed it on to upstream and downstream partners. They acquired customers through massive offline sales teams leveraging traditional relationships, achieving decent business progress. But when calculating profits, they were surprisingly low. Why? Not because of bad debts, but because of high offline personnel costs—sales, business development, and administrative overhead—plus the need for customer acquisition, relationship maintenance, and commercial documentation. Despite having so-called internet products and systems, most companies cannot efficiently manage large-scale organizations. This leads to high labor costs that severely impact profitability. Although B2B is heavy and offline promotion is sometimes necessary, the minimum efficient radius for offline promotion and business models is often overlooked by most B2B companies. Exploring models around core efficiency improvements is the only way to find a business model that fits your industry and has internet value. Profit Models In traditional distribution and trade models: trade margins, channel agency distribution, market speculation, logistics and delivery, advance payments, trade financing, etc., are the most common and intertwined profit models. Different roles in different market ecosystems often have different profit model focuses. E-commerce uses bestsellers to drive traffic and makes money from long-tail categories; offline hypermarkets sell eggs at a discount to attract queues of elderly shoppers, then profit from products along the winding shopping path; McDonald's sells its signature burgers cheaply and often offers coupons, but makes excess profits on fries, drinks, and toys. The business logic is the same. Matchmaking-based B2B e-commerce follows the same traffic-driving model. But it faces three challenges: First, can the matchmaking traffic continue to flow through the funnel of information, logistics, and supply chain finance? I described this funnel logic in a previous article. Widening, deepening, and penetrating the funnel is both a key point and a difficulty. Second, can the bestseller traffic from matchmaking lead to one-stop procurement of other products? Many platforms tout "one-stop" services, but this is constrained by national conditions and hard to achieve. From a supply chain procurement perspective, multiple suppliers, repeated price comparisons, and multiple decision-makers make one-stop procurement difficult. Third, can the relationship-based business model of B2B truly be broken by B2B platforms? We must better leverage the connecting role of people in the ecosystem so that all reconstructed links benefit. Sustained benefits are the only way to maintain B2B relationships. In fact, profit models come in many forms; the key is how different ecosystems play.
